Just over a decade after the first powered aeroplane flight, fearless pioneers were flying over the battlefields of France in flimsy biplanes. As more military aircraft took to the skies, they were equipped with weapons and their pilots began to develop tactics to take down enemy aviators. In 1915 the term 'ace' was coined to denote a pilot adept at downing enemy aircraft, and top aces like Albert Ball and the Red Baron became household names. Flying more advanced fighters, top aces would accrue scores of over 100 in the swirling dogfights of WWII. This book covers the history of the fighter ace from the first developments in 1915 to the jet aces of the later 20th century. AUTHORS: John Sadler BA (Hons) M.Phil, FRHistS, FSA (Scotl.) is an author, lecturer, battlefield tour guide and historical interpreter. He has been a visiting lecturer at the North East Centre for Lifelong Learning teaching war studies for fifteen years and has some thirty published titles in print or preparation. He is an experienced battlefield tour guide for both world wars in Europe and for a range of earlier conflicts. As a historical interpreter and partner in Time Bandits, he has appeared in a wide variety of guises in museums, galleries, schools, the community and heritage sites from Ramses II of Egypt to WWII Home Guard and Auxiliaries. He is married with two daughters and lives in mid-Northumberland. Rosie Serdiville is a writer and educator with a particular interest in radical history. She works together with John Sadler in schools and for heritage sites, often using our very different viewpoints to provide an alternative commentary on historical events. She is Vice President of the Society of Antiquaries of Newcastle upon Tyne, and co-author with John Sadler of 7 military history titles.
